What is Clove Bud Essential Oil?
Clove bud essential oil is extracted from the flower buds of the clove tree, Syzygium aromaticum. The oil has a warm, spicy scent and is rich in a natural compound called eugenol. This ingredient is what gives clove oil its strong antiseptic, anti-inflammatory, and analgesic properties.
In Kenya, clove oil is quickly becoming a household favorite due to its versatility. It blends well with other oils such as cinnamon, orange, and peppermint, making it a valuable addition to your wellness routine.
Top Health Benefits
Here are the top ways this oil can support your health:
1. Natural Pain Reliever
Clove bud essential oil is powerful oil for relieving pain. The eugenol in the oil works as a natural numbing agent. It can help with:
- Toothaches and gum pain
- Sore muscles and joint pain
- Headaches when diluted and applied to the temples
2. Boosts Immunity
The oil is rich in antioxidants that support your body’s defense system. Using it during flu season may help reduce the risk of infections. You can diffuse a few drops at home or mix with a carrier oil and apply to the chest or back.
3. Fights Oral Infections
In many Kenyan homes, clove oil is used for oral hygiene. It helps kill bacteria, reduce inflammation, and freshen breath. Use a diluted drop on your toothbrush or as a mouth rinse. However, avoid swallowing it and always dilute with a carrier oil.
4. Supports Skin Health
When diluted properly, clove oil can help treat acne and skin irritations. Its antibacterial properties reduce breakouts, while its anti-inflammatory effect soothes redness and swelling.
Apply a mix of 1 drop clove bud oil and 1 tablespoon of coconut oil to affected areas. Do a patch test before using it on your face.

How to Use Safely
Even though Clove bud essential oil is powerful oil, it must be used carefully:
- Always dilute before applying to the skin
- Avoid direct contact with eyes and sensitive areas
- Do not ingest without advice from a qualified health professional
- Keep away from children and pets
For most people, a 2 percent dilution is safe. This means about 12 drops of clove oil in 30 ml of carrier oil like coconut or jojoba.
